Springtime on Pennsauken Creek.

Like many of the Delaware’s tidal creeks, Pennsauken Creek offers a path through working people’s communities, mixed with natural settings and traffic sounds. Paddling the lower four miles on a falling tide exposes extensive mudflats. Turtles slide off the dark mud and into the creek on the approach of a kayak. Blue herons and egrets take flight simultaneously, but the geese stay put and sound off, contrasting with the billboards, factories, and businesses along Rt 73. Palmyra Cove Nature Park is at the mouth, and to the south, views of the Betsy Ross and Delair bridges.

Before you go

  • Launch from Forklanding Rd. on an Ebb Tide.
  • Tidal Current Information based on Fisher Point  
  • There is minimal parking.
  • There are no facilities.
